The Concrete Slab Water Extraction Process: What to Expect
Our team follows a proven process to ensure your Concrete Slab Water Extraction is done efficiently and effectively. We understand the importance of speed and accuracy in this type of situation, which is why we’ve developed a streamlined approach that gets the job done right the first time. Our process is designed to reduce disruption to your daily life, and we’ll have you back in your home or business in no time.
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our technicians will arrive at your property within 60 minutes to assess the damage and create a customized plan to extract the water and dry your concrete slab. We’ll use specialized equipment to identify the source of the leak and develop a strategy to prevent further damage. This step typically takes 30-60 minutes, depending on the complexity of the job.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Using our heavy-duty water extraction equipment, we’ll remove the standing water from your concrete slab. We’ll work efficiently to reduce the amount of time spent on this step, usually around 2-4 hours, depending on the size of the affected area.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Next, we’ll use our industrial-grade drying equipment to remove excess moisture from your concrete slab. This step is crucial in preventing mold and mildew growth, and we’ll ensure your property is dry and safe within 3-5 days.
Step 4: Inspection and Repair
After the drying process is complete, our technicians will conduct a thorough inspection to identify any remaining damage. We’ll work with you to develop a repair plan, which may include replacing damaged materials or performing cosmetic repairs. This step typically takes 1-3 hours, depending on the extent of the damage.

Concrete Slab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water spill on a concrete slab | Yes | No | You can likely handle this on your own with some basic equipment. |
| Large water spill on a concrete slab | No | Yes | A large spill need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age. |
| Water damage from a burst pipe | No | Yes | A burst pipe needs immediate attention to prevent further damage and health hazards. |
| Musty odors or discoloration on a concrete slab | No | Yes | These signs can show serious water damage or mold growth, needing professional attention. |

Concrete Slab Water Extraction Cost in Peachtree Corners, GA
The cost of Concrete Slab Water Extraction can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Peachtree Corners, GA. Our estimates are free and based on an on-site assessment, so you’ll know exactly what to expect before we begin work.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ed |
| Drying and d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ed |
| Inspection and repair | $500 – $2,000 | Extent of damage, type of repairs needed |
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ment, but we’ll work with you to develop a customized plan that fits your budget and needs.
